
The Women Leadership Summit, which is a flagship event of the Women in Management (WIM) club at Indian Institute of Management, Bangalore will be hosted on Saturday, 9 January, at 9:30 am onward. The location of this annual event will be at the IIM-B auditorium, and also the central pergola in the Bannerghatta campus.
With a theme - ‘Take the Leap’, the summit is about the challenges that are faced by women in the industry and how women leaders can be encouraged by different stakeholders. Rama Bijapurkar, a member of Board of Governors at IIM Ahmedabad, and Sanjaya Sharma, who is the founder and CEO of Tata ClassEdge and Tata Interactive Systems will deliver the keynote address.
A panel discussion titled 'Ascent to the Pinnacle' will feature the founder and CEO of Active Holiday Company Gauri Jayaram; Rama NS, former vice president, Infosys ,and Gita Sen, gender and development expert at IIM-B.
There will also be Subha Chandrasekaran, senior vice president -TTS ops Head at Citibank India, conducting a workshop on financial planning. The seats for this workshop will be available on unreserved basis.
